Sometimes when I haven't driven in a few days and then I drive only a short distance, I notice that the battery only has 2 bars of charge but the motor is still drawing power from it as well as using the ICE to power the car. Even with no acceleration or large demand for power, I can't get the car to use the ICE to power the car by itself while charging the battery. Do you know what I mean? This is one of the keys to the "pulse and glide" technique, to drive gently and allow the ICE the charge the battery when it doesn't have enough juice for ev mode. Are there some times when the car wants to drain the battery to a certain point before allowing it to charge up again?

That's not really how it works. It recharges once warm-up is complete and when demand is lower. During warm up, acceleration or climbs it will still draw from the battery until you hit the 40% mark if the ECU determines that that will be most efficient.
